#66d7e2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#66d7e2 is composed of 40% red, 84.3%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.9% cyan, 4.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 185.3 degrees, a saturation of 68.1% and a lightness of 64.3%. #66d7e2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ccffff with #00afc5.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

#66d7e2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#66d7e2 has RGB values of R:102, G:215, B:226 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0.05,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 6739938.

Shades and Tints of #66d7e2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020b0c is the darkest color, while #fafef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#66d7e2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9ea9aa is the less saturated color, while #4aeefe is the most saturated one.
